Linear and Non-Linear Gravitational Corrections to Conventional Gravitational Lensing

Presented by Bin Chen, University of Oklahoma

I will talk about the Swiss cheese gravitational lensing theory on which our group has been working recently. We claim that a correction to both bending angles and time delays are necessary at the percentage level. We also have found a non-negligible effect of the cosmological constant on cluster lensing. I will also briefly talk about cosmic lensing in a perturbed FLRW universe and the integrated Sachs-Wolfe effect induced by large scale structures.
